Disregarding Surface Area Preparation
When it involves commercial painting jobs, skimping on surface area preparation can truly establish you back. You could assume it's simply a fast action, yet ignoring it can bring about peeling off paint, uneven finishes, and ultimately, pricey fixings.
Beginning by thoroughly cleaning the surfaces. Dust, grease, and crud can all disrupt bond, so order your pressure washing machine or scrub brush and get to work.
Next off, examine for any type of damage. Splits, holes, or flaking paint need your interest prior to you even think about using a fresh coat. Spot these problems with the right products to make certain a smooth, also surface area.
Do not forget to sand down harsh locations; a little initiative here can make an enormous distinction in the final appearance.
Finally, take into consideration keying your surface areas. An excellent primer functions as an obstacle, enhancing bond and helping your overcoat look its ideal. It may feel like an extra action, but it's vital for durability.

Underestimating Job Timeline
Underestimating the project timeline can thwart even the best-planned commercial paint undertakings. You may believe that a straightforward paint task will certainly conclude quickly, yet unexpected problems commonly arise.
From weather condition hold-ups to surface prep work complications, these aspects can extend your timeline substantially.
It's crucial to examine the extent of job properly. If you don't factor in prep work time, like patching walls or fining sand surfaces, you're establishing yourself up for failure.
You should also consider the drying out time in between layers, which can take longer than anticipated, particularly in damp conditions.
Connecting with your paint specialist is essential. They can offer insights on sensible timelines based upon their experience.
See to it you construct in some buffer time for unforeseen delays. If you do not, you risk not only extending the task but also disrupting your procedures or the routine of your lessees.
Picking Inappropriate Materials
Selecting the right products for your commercial paint job can make all the distinction in attaining a long lasting and cosmetically pleasing end result. When you select unsuitable products, you run the risk of not only the top quality of the surface however likewise the long life of the work.
For example, using interior paint for an exterior project can cause peeling and fading as a result of weather exposure. It's critical to match the particular paint kind to the environment where it will certainly be applied. If you're repainting high-traffic areas, choose sturdy, washable surfaces that can stand up to damage.
Additionally, take into consideration the substrate; various products like drywall, metal, or concrete need specially developed paints for ideal bond and performance.
Do not neglect the importance of primer either. Avoiding this action or making use of the incorrect kind can threaten the entire job. Constantly seek advice from your paint provider or a specialist to ensure you're choosing the very best materials for your specific requirements.
